Transaction 7bb665acd771449e76f39e03b4ff15c53e8b4acd8a4e609300213b1f33d9ae81

block
e322ec6bd91f1dc612c35496ab0d5ef193a3969b93a9ee850932af7c149c0f79

1 Input

23 Outputs